Q2. On a test consisting of 80 questions, Eve answered 75% of the first
satela [25.4K]

Answer: 95%

Explanation:

To obtain score of 80% on entire exam means the student have to answer

(80/100)×80 = 64 correct answers

Student have already answered 75% of the first 60 questions correctly meaning

(75/100)×60=45 correct answers from first 60 questions

Remaining correct answers s/he have to answer

64-45=19

So from remaining 20 questions s/he have to answer 19 correct questions that is

20 × (x/100) = 19

x = 19 ×(100/20)

x = 95%

Which of the statements are evidence that gases do not always behave ideally?
solniwko [45]

The statements which is evident that gases do not always behave ideally include the following:

  • It is impossible to compress a gas enough so that it takes up no volume.
  • CO2 gas becomes dry ice (solid co2) at 1 atm and –78.5∘c.
  • At 4 k and 1 atm, helium is a liquid.

<h3>What is an Ideal gas?</h3>

This is the type of gas  in which all collisions between atoms or molecules are perfectly elastic.

It has no intermolecular attractive force and not all gases behave ideally as can be seen in the above examples.
